Output 17254a4edc20156452ff2e1ba0de49210ca95568eaa6beeb33792bf6f4968920:3

value
670004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b463529fa1dd24190eb84bcf53072feba0d9db OP_EQUAL
address
3DWqBsCtnMJnMVhN4iYCnd8dYgCYgdamu1
transaction
17254a4edc20156452ff2e1ba0de49210ca95568eaa6beeb33792bf6f4968920
spent
true